Intern, Business Development

The Firm
MiddleGround Capital (“MiddleGround”) is a private equity firm headquartered in Lexington, KY, that invests in B2B companies in the industrial and specialty distribution sectors in the middle-market. We are differentiated as true operators who have experience working in, and managing businesses that range from the lower middle-market to Fortune-500 companies.

The Position

MiddleGround is targeting part-time interns to work on collaborative team-specific projects, as well as broader exposure within the firm. As a Business Development (BD) Intern, you will support our sourcing strategy and relationship management efforts and complete final project outlined at the beginning of your internship, with a presentation at the end of the term.

You’ll get exposure to private equity deal flow, CRM database management (e.g., DealCloud), and market research, all while collaborating with internal teams and industry-facing contacts.

This is a paid position based onsite in Lexington, KY and is perfect for a student looking for an internship in Private Equity and to gain experience in a fast-paced, professional BD environment. You will learn from industry experts and gain insight into how deals are sourced and evaluated.
